minor tweaks
authorBrian Paul <brian.paul@tungstengraphics.com>
Tue, 10 Aug 2004 15:34:51 +0000 (15:34 +0000)
committerBrian Paul <brian.paul@tungstengraphics.com>
Tue, 10 Aug 2004 15:34:51 +0000 (15:34 +0000)
progs/tests/bufferobj.c

index bbfa38a1d84d219bf38a18891bad824a32309431..93e3f8b82093ffc676238789b3fa4167f9c90cd1 100644 (file)
@@ -36,7 +36,7 @@ static void CheckError(int line)
 {
    GLenum err = glGetError();
    if (err) {
-      printf("GL Error %d at line %d\n", (int) err, line);
+      printf("GL Error 0x%x at line %d\n", (int) err, line);
    }
 }
 
@@ -179,7 +179,9 @@ static void MakeObject1(struct object *obj)
    for (i = 0; i < 500; i++)
       buffer[i] = i & 0xff;
 
+   obj->BufferID = 0;
    glGenBuffersARB(1, &obj->BufferID);
+   assert(obj->BufferID != 0);
    glBindBufferARB(GL_ARRAY_BUFFER_ARB, obj->BufferID);
    glBufferDataARB(GL_ARRAY_BUFFER_ARB, 500, buffer, GL_STATIC_DRAW_ARB);